HI ALL , PUT THIS PIC IN LOCAL ANNUAL PRINT COMPETITION GOT 19 POINTS FROM 20 BUT WAS NOT AT JUDGEING AS I WORK SHIFTS SO MAYBE SOMEONE CAN EXPLAIN IN LAMENS TERMS WHAT JUDGES COMMENTS MEAN ,HERE ARE THE COMMENTS.

This image is well balanced and the hulls are in a good position within the print. The light & shadows could be more worked and with some selective contrast work to bring the scene more alive.

Meaning that some parts are too contrasty, others not contrasty enough, the over all tonal balance is not good. Time of year/weather does not help. The sky is very noisy like it was just blown out. You almost have to introduce an artificial sky if you don't have a half filter.
